在云计算和数据中心环境中,实现跨区域、跨网络的高效通信至关重要,EVPN(Ethernet VPN),作为一种基于以太网的VPN技术,正逐渐成为解决这一问题的关键方案,本文将深入探讨EVPN的基本原理、优势以及其在网络架构中的应用。
什么是EVPN?
EVPN是一种以太网VPN技术,它允许用户在一个或多个自治系统(AS)之间传输以太网数据包,EVPN的核心思想是在VPN中模拟二层以太网,使得不同地理位置的设备能够像在同一个局域网内一样进行通信。
EVPN的主要特性
- MAC地址学习:EVPN通过MAC地址通告机制,在不同的VTEP(虚拟隧道端点)之间交换MAC地址信息。
- ARP代理功能:EVPN支持ARP代理功能,使得远程站点的IP地址与MAC地址映射关系能够被正确传递。
- 多租户支持:EVPN可以同时支持多个租户的以太网流量,并且每个租户的流量相互隔离。
- QoS支持:EVPN提供了服务质量(QoS)保障,确保关键业务流量得到优先处理。
EVPN的工作原理
EVPN的工作原理主要依赖于以下几种协议:
- BGP EVPN Type-0/Type-2:用于在PE(Provider Edge)路由器之间交换MAC地址和路由信息。
- BGP EVPN Type-3:用于在PE路由器之间交换ARP信息。
- BGP EVPN Type-4/Type-5:用于在PE路由器之间交换路由控制信息。
当一个数据包从本地站点发送到远程站点时,数据包会经过一系列的处理步骤:
- 源VTEP捕获数据包:源VTEP捕获本地站点的数据包,并将其封装成EVPN格式。
- MAC地址通告:源VTEP将目标站点的MAC地址通告给其他VTEP。
- ARP代理:如果目标站点的ARP信息需要更新,源VTEP会向其他VTEP发送ARP请求。
- 数据包转发:数据包经过路径选择和封装后,通过MPLS隧道传输到目标VTEP。
- 目标VTEP解封装:目标VTEP解封装数据包,并将其发送到目标站点。
EVPN的优势
- 简化网络管理:EVPN简化了网络管理,使得不同地理位置的设备能够像在同一个局域网内一样进行通信。
- 提高安全性:EVPN提供了MAC地址认证和加密功能,提高了网络的安全性。
- 支持多租户:EVPN可以同时支持多个租户的以太网流量,并且每个租户的流量相互隔离。
- 灵活性:EVPN可以根据业务需求灵活调整网络拓扑结构,满足不断变化的业务需求。
EVPN的应用场景
EVPN广泛应用于以下场景:
- 云数据中心互联:EVPN可以实现云数据中心之间的高效互联,支持跨数据中心的以太网流量传输。
- 分支机构互联:EVPN可以实现企业总部与各个分支机构之间的高效互联,支持跨地域的以太网流量传输。
- 虚拟化环境:EVPN可以实现虚拟化环境之间的高效互联,支持跨主机的以太网流量传输。
EVPN作为一种基于以太网的VPN技术,具有多种优势,如简化网络管理、提高安全性、支持多租户等,随着云计算和数据中心环境的不断发展,EVPN将在未来发挥越来越重要的作用,希望本文对您理解EVPN有所帮助。
本文由阿里云Qwen撰写,旨在为您提供关于EVPN的全面介绍和理解,如果您有任何问题或需要进一步的信息,请随时联系我们。

半仙加速器

